23 September 2005.
Gansu Sheng, China
Locality: Gansu Province: Zhou Qu: Sha Tan, Dai Hai Gou
Coordinates: 33.6287, 104.2610
(Map it)
Elevation: 1993m.
Environment description: mesic, deciduous area, but heavily cut and browsed; open, east-running stream, upstream from point where small north-running stream of #044-045 flows into this larger stream, 30 degrees, N, organic, rocky loam,
Comment: Tree; height 5 meters, D.B.H. 10 centimeters; multi-stemmed. Bark smooth, gray. Leaves elliptic; serrate margins; 6 centimeters wide by 10 centimeters long. Fruit: catkin with bracts subtending seeds; 2 centimeters wide by 7 centimeters long., Collected from several plants., From G.Hibben and Oren McBee.,
